association of lipid profile and inflammatory markers with covid-19 severity and outcome

چکیده
|
Background: covid-19 is a highly contagious disease that has already affected millions of people worldwide. proinflammatory cytokines in covid-19 infection change lipid metabolism and profile. this study investigates the association between lipid profile and inflammatory markers with the severity and outcome of covid-19 patients referred to a teaching hospital in mazandaran province, iran, during april-may and july-august 2020. methods: this study was conducted on 140 patients with covid-19 based on their clinical symptoms, imaging results, and laboratory findings. patients were categorized as severe and non-severe groups based on the centers for disease control and prevention criteria. blood samples (5-7 ml) were collected from patients after 12 hours of fasting. serum triglycerides, cholesterol, highdensity lipoprotein-cholesterol (hdl-c), and low-density lipoprotein-cholesterol (ldl-c) levels were measured using pars azmoon kits (hitachi ltd). results: of 140 covid-19 patients, 33.57% had severe and 66.43% had non-severe disease. patients with severe disease had a significantly lower mean ldl serum level than those with non-severe involvement (56.39±3.62 vs 70.10±3.74 mg/dl) (p=0.023). patients in the intensive care units had significantly lower hdl, ldl, and cholesterol serum levels than those hospitalized in other parts (p=0.006, p=0.002, and p=0.002, respectively). there was a significant negative correlation between hdl serum level and c-reactive protein (crp) and erythrocyte sedimentation rate (esr) (p=0.0001 and r=-0.482) and (p=0.01 and r=-0.258), respectively. additionally, there was a significant correlation between cholesterol level and crp, triglycerides, and esr (p=0.016 and p=0.02, respectively). conclusion: the present study highlights the potential of lipid profiling as a cost-effective and accessible marker to assess covid-19 severity and prognosis.
